High Temperature Rail Replacement for Industrial Furnace

Deformed and discolored high temperature rail track due to heat oxidation inside industrial furnace.

Project Background

A furnace equipment manufacturer contacted us after noticing serious oxidation and deformation on their existing A100 rails.
The rails operated under continuous temperatures above 600°C, where ordinary carbon steel gradually lost strength and surface stability. This affected the alignment of the furnace trolley and increased maintenance downtime.

High Temperature Rail Material Assessment

At such high temperatures, most standard rail materials are not suitable.
Even 16Mo3, a commonly used heat-resistant alloy steel, starts losing mechanical strength above 500°C.
For stable performance in high-temperature but low-load conditions, austenitic stainless steel is preferred due to its excellent oxidation resistance.

Working TemperatureRecommended MaterialTypical Application
300–450°CU75VCrMo (pearlitic heat-resistant steel)Coking and sintering plant conveyors
450–600°CX10CrNiMoVNb9-1 (martensitic heat-resistant steel)Waste incineration and kiln-area rails
600°C and above310S stainless steel or ceramic-coated railHigh-temperature furnaces and testing equipment

Glory Track Solution

After evaluating the operating environment, we supplied custom-processed 310S stainless steel rails for the furnace system.
310S provides:

  • Reliable oxidation resistance up to 800°C
  • Good thermal stability during heating and cooling cycles
  • Excellent corrosion resistance in oxidizing atmospheres

Since 310S has lower yield strength compared with carbon steel, it was used in non-load-bearing sections of the furnace, ensuring both temperature endurance and structural safety.

Our machining process included:

  • Precision cutting and finishing to match the existing track layout
  • Surface treatment to improve heat expansion tolerance
  • Dimensional and weld-fit inspection before shipment

Result

The new rails have operated stably at 600–700°C, showing no signs of oxidation or deformation after long-term use.
The furnace trolley runs smoothly, and maintenance requirements have been significantly reduced.
